How to take care of newly bought gladiolus

1. Potting soil

It is best to use plastic pots or unglazed ceramic pots to grow gladiolus at home. Don't just pick a pot and plant it, otherwise it will be detrimental to the growth of gladiolus. As for the soil, it is preferred to use sandy soil with good drainage and thick soil layer. Be careful not to change the soil during the potting period.

2. Watering

Don't water the newly bought gladiolus too much. One reason is that it does not require much water, and the other is that its root system has poor absorption capacity. Excessive watering can easily lead to water accumulation. Just water it appropriately to keep the soil moist.

3. Fertilization

Gladiolus likes fertilizer. After buying it home, you can apply some decomposed liquid fertilizer to the soil to promote the growth of the plant. But be careful not to add too much, otherwise the plant will not be able to fully absorb it, it will easily burn the roots and damage the plant.

4. Temperature

Temperature has a great influence on the growth of gladiolus. It is best to control the temperature between 15-25 degrees, which can allow gladiolus to adapt to the new environment faster and resume normal growth.
